According to him, mobilization rhetoric has increased in the information space of Russia, and Russian politicians recognize that there is a full -scale war in Ukraine, not a "special operation". "Zyuganov (Head of the Communist Party, ed. ) And other Russian politicians say that yes, really, there is a war, and that the Russian army cannot cope, it is necessary to declare war and mobilization," he said.
In Ukrainian intelligence, it was also told that the public opinion of the Russians is formed through statements that the Russian Federation is fighting not only with Ukraine but also with the West and NATO. Vadim Skibitsky added that the issue of announcement of mobilization in Russia has been discussed in the Kremlin from the beginning of a full -scale invasion.
The Russian authorities apply different approaches to replenish the losses: they form "volunteer" battalions, battalions from reservists, attract PVC, and form the third corps of the army. "This is all aimed at replenishing the resources and continuing further active fighting," GUR said. However, he believes that the announcement of general mobilization will hit Putin's regime. According to him, it will mean the failure of "special operation" and understanding that it is a war.
In addition, the beginning of open mobilization will be in hand for Ukraine, because young people do not want to go to fight. "Therefore, the very announcement of general mobilization will be an indicator that will show how the Russian people are ready for the continuation of this bloody war," Skibitsky summed up. We will remind, on September 20 the State Duma of the Russian Federation introduced into the Criminal Code the concept of "mobilization", "wartime" and "martial law".
